The topic of this class was about content-based approaches to languages teaching and learning. Firstly, we learned about two schools that focused on global edication. Sophia university is famous for offering-high-level language education, including a lot of English- medium programs. Linden Hall school tackled with International Baccalaureate Diploma Program. Recent developments in immersion education has 3 principles, comprehensible input , structured and extended output, and focus on form, proactive and reactive.
